In order to conserve battery, I turn off mobile data and turn on Wifi whenever I'm at home. The problem is that Wifi seems to disconnect automatically whenever my phone is in sleep mode and I won't be able to receive notifications from email, twitter and etc. Anyone knows how to keep my Wifi connected though my phone is in sleep mode?

That's by design: If I remember right, WiFi only keeps a persistent connection if your device is plugged in; otherwise it will connect when you wake it. If you're jailbroken you can use an app called Insomnia to keep the connection live, but (ironically, in this case) it will drain your battery faster.

(So basically, in your case you'd need to keep it plugged in or in a dock.)

Edit: Are you turning off Cellular Data in this screen?

If so, what I'm reading seems to indicate that with Cellular Data switched off you should be able to have a persistent WiFi connection--BUT that it would actually use MORE battery when set up that way.

So I'd say either keep it plugged in for WiFi or just leave leave your data on...unless you're in a really flaky connection area, I really don't think the data connection is going to affect your battery that much. Good luck!
